The diagram shows the electronic structure of an atom. What type of particles are represented by the crosses?

Answer:

electrons are represented by the crosses

Explanation:

The rings represent electron shells. The outermost electrons are called valence electrons. Valence electrons are used during bonding.

Answer:

electrons

Explanation:

The red dot in the center is the nucleus and it has protons and neutrons.

Since it has 12 electrons this means (if it is a neutral atom and not an ion) it will have 12 protons which makes it a magnesium atom.
